Ingredients

  • 1 ½cupswhite sugar

  • 4eggs, beaten until light and fluffy

  • 4cupsheavy whipping cream

  • 2cupsmilk

  • 4teaspoonsvanilla extract

  • 4teaspoonsalmond extract

  • 1 ¼cupssliced almonds

Cooking Directions

  1. Beat sugar into eggs in small amounts, assuring each addition dissolves completely before introducing the next.

  2. Whisk cream, milk, vanilla extract, and almond extract into egg mixture; fold almonds into mixture.

  3. Pour into the container of an ice cream maker; freeze according to the manufacturer’s instructions.

Editor’s Note:

This recipe contains raw egg. We recommend that pregnant women, young children, the elderly, and the infirm do not consume raw egg. Learn more about egg safety from our article, How to Make Your Eggs Safe.
